GARCIA FAURA advances its sustainability goals
The company has recently developed a mitigation plan for climate neutrality and an ecological balance sheet for its economic activity. Both actions are aimed at improving the company’s ecological footprint.
In recent months, GARCIA FAURA has been working on two projects aimed at reducing its ecological footprint and moving towards a greener and more sustainable business model. These are the mitigation plan for climate neutrality and the ecological balance of economic activity.
The mitigation plan for climate neutrality is GARCIA FAURA‘s first sustainability statement in accordance with European standards. The plan is based on the calculation of the current corporate carbon footprint, from which the company has established a structured roadmap for the progressive decarbonisation of its activity.
With this letter of commitment, GARCIA FAURA has set itself the target of reducing greenhouse gas emissions by at least 42% by 2030. In this way, the company is ahead of the entry into force of general legislation, which will oblige companies to take action to mitigate the effects of climate change.
In terms of the ecological balance of economic activity, this is a circular economy project through which GARCIA FAURA has been able to use the EcoBalance tool to assess the environmental impacts at the beginning of the production process, both in terms of raw material and energy consumption, and at the end, such as the emissions associated with the product.
In this way, the company can identify critical points that can be used to implement strategic improvement opportunities structured around four areas: sustainable purchasing, waste management, renewable energy and sustainable mobility.
